Challenges in International Money Transfers
-
High Fees: One of the most significant drawbacks of international money transfers is the associated fees. These fees can vary widely depending on the service provider and often include transaction fees, currency conversion fees, and sometimes even margin rates for exchange rates.
-
Slow Processing Times: Another common issue is slow processing times for international transfers. Depending on where you are sending money from or to, you may have to wait several days for your funds to arrive at your destination.
-
Security Risks: Security is a paramount concern when it comes to international money transfers. Transactions can be vulnerable to fraud, identity theft, and other cyber threats if proper security measures are not in place.
-
Regulatory Compliance: Operating internationally requires strict adherence to regulatory guidelines regarding anti-money laundering (AML) and know-your-customer (KYC) policies. Non-compliance can lead to hefty fines or even legal action.

The Future of Global Payments
As technology advances further, we can expect even more innovations in global payments:
- Integration with IoT devices could allow for automated cross-border transactions based on real-time data.
- Artificial intelligence could play a larger role in personalizing financial services based on individual needs.
- Blockchain technology could revolutionize how cross-border payments are processed by offering near-instantaneous settlements with enhanced transparency.
- Mobile payment apps could become a one-stop solution for all financial needs, from transferring funds internationally to paying bills abroad.
